The 52 km tour with an elevation gain of 1,010 meters takes you past fascinating wood art and old water wheels via the villages of Holzhau, Hermsdorf, Frauenstein, Mulda and Dorfchemnitz.

Through the valley of clattering mills into the adventure world of Blockhausen. The huge wooden water wheels drive the mills in the Gimmlitz valley with a powerful squeaking and rushing sound. They spit out a curtain of clear water. The hammers and mortars of the grinding and stamping mills develop enormous forces that you could not muster on your own. Enormous forces are also developed by the screeching chainsaws that carve amazingly filigree works of art from the gigantic blocks of wood at the annual chainsaw world championship. In Blockhausen, you are immersed in a gigantic fantasy settlement made of wood in the middle of the Martin family's private forest. There is probably nowhere else with such a large collection of wooden sculptures. The highlight is the 40-meter-long table. Carved from a single tree trunk, it is listed in the Guinness Book of Records.
